Primeval Reptiles: Past the Dinosaurs
While dinosaurs often dominate the popular image of primeval reptiles, the fossil record reveals a much richer and more diverse history stretching far past their reign. Long before the Jurassic period, a multitude of reptilian creatures thrived in Earth’s evolving ecosystems. These weren’t simply “proto-dinosaurs”; they represent a vast and often overlooked lineage, including oceanic reptiles like the placodonts – bizarre predators that combined features of lizards, crocodiles, and turtles – and the often-ignored initial ancestors of modern lizards and snakes. Many persisted through multiple mass extinctions, demonstrating a remarkable capacity for adaptation. The study of these underappreciated reptiles offers invaluable insights into the origins of the reptilian clade and a more complete understanding of life during the Mesozoic eras.
Discovering Jurassic Giants: Studying Dinosaur Biology
Beyond the colossal remains we see in museums, lies a fascinating world of dinosaur science. Paleontologists are increasingly utilizing cutting-edge techniques – from analyzing fossilized bone structure to modeling biomechanics – to reconstruct how these ancient creatures operated. We're beginning to grasp not just *what* they ate, but *how* their digestive systems processed it; not just their magnitude, but the intricate interplay of muscles and framework that allowed them to travel. New discoveries about dinosaur maturation rates, respiratory systems, and even potential plumage are constantly challenging our previous beliefs about these truly astonishing Jurassic giants, painting an ever-more-detailed picture of their elaborate existence. Furthermore, investigations into dinosaur conduct – gleaned from trackways and potential nesting sites – provide tantalizing glimpses into their communal lives.
